The Belton BUNCO Group

2:00pm–4:00pm
Adults
Belton Library
Library Branch: Belton Library
Room: Friends of the Library Meeting Room
Age Group: Adults
Program Type: Movies, Games & Anime
Event Details:

Bunco is a dice game where players take turns rolling three dice in an attempt to score points and have the highest score at the end of six rounds. The game can be played with 12 or more players, divided into groups of four.
